Competency: Planning and organising (essential) – Is methodical. Able to plan own work over short timescales for routine or familiar tasks and processes. Has a good attention to detail to follow strict instructions. Is punctual and reliable. (必填) Description: In the context of exam, invigilators must plan their work well because they will handle lots of tasks and exam information/materials as well as ensure the strictest security concerning test materials while he/she needs to monitor candidates’ behaviour all the time. We need invigilators who can stay organised and focus on the tasks at hand. Organisational skills can include general organising, time management and coordinating resource. 91个competency是指在某个领域或职业中所需具备的能力和素质的集合。这些能力和素质可以分为不同的类别,如专业知识、技能、沟通能力、领导能力等等。以下是其中一些常见的competency:
1. 专业知识:具备相关领域的学科知识,理解专业术语和概念,并能应用于实际情境中。
2. 执行力:能够有效地组织和管理项目,制定计划并按时完成任务。
3. 创新思维:具备创造性和灵活性,能够提出新观点和解决问题的方法。
4. 团队合作:擅长与他人合作,建立良好的工作关系,共同实现共同目标。
5. 沟通能力:能够清晰准确地表达自己的想法,以及倾听和理解他人的意见。
6. 问题解决:能够分析问题、找出解决方案,并采取相应的行动。
7. 领导能力:能够激励和指导团队成员,推动组织向前发展。
8. 自我管理:具备良好的时间管理和自我组织能力,能够高效地处理工作任务。
9. 适应能力:能够适应不同的工作环境和变化,并迅速调整自己的工作方式。
10. 客户导向:关注客户需求,并提供优质的服务和解决方案。
这只是91个competency中的一小部分,每个人在不同的领域中可能会有不同的competency要求。在职业发展过程中,不断学习和提高这些competency是非常重要的,以便更好地适应和发展自己的职业。
